Amos and the Cosmic Imagination (Society for Old Testament Study)

James R. Linville
4.9/5 (30672 ratings)
Description:Said to contain the words of the earliest of the biblical prophets (8th century BCE), the "Book of Amos" is reinterpreted by James Linville in light of new and sometimes controversial historical approaches to the Bible. Amos is read as the literary product of the Persian-era community in Judah. Its representations of divine-human communication are investigated in the context of the ancient writers' own role as transmitters and shapers of religious traditions.
